Summary of ANALOG DEVICES LT8491 BUCK-BOOST BATTERY CHARGE CONTROLLER
Analog Devices LT8491 is a buck-boost battery charge controller that provides CCCV charging for SLA, flooded, gel, and lithium-ion batteries. It operates with input voltages above, below, or equal to battery voltage, suitable for solar panels or DC supplies. Key features include wide VIN and VBAT ranges, single-inductor buck-boost topology, automatic MPPT, temperature compensation, I2C telemetry/configuration, internal EEPROM, four feedback loops, synchronizable fixed switching frequency, and a 64-lead QFN package.

Analog Devices Inc. LT8491 Buck-Boost Battery Charge Controller implements a constant-current constant voltage (CCCV) charging profile used for most battery types. This includes sealed lead-acid (SLA), flooded, gel, and lithium-ion.
The device operates from input voltages above, below, or equal to the output voltage and is powered by a solar panel or DC power supply.

Features
- VIN Range: 6V to 80V
- VBAT Range: 1.3V to 80V
- Single Inductor Allows VIN Above, Below, or Equal to VBAT
- Automatic MPPT for Solar Powered Charging
- Automatic Temperature Compensation
- I2C Telemetry and Configuration
- Internal EEPROM for Configuration Storage
- Operation from Solar Panel or DC Supply
- Four Integrated Feedback Loops
- Synchronizable Fixed Frequency: 100kHz to 400kHz
- 64-Lead (7mm x 11mm x 0.75mm) QFN Package
